VH101 Personal Vortex electric space heaters recalled over fire hazard

Recalled product: VH101 Personal Vortex electric space heaters
Recall date
August 22, 2018
Source
U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C)
Official notice title
Vornado Air Reannounces Recall of Electric Space Heaters Following Report of Death; Fire and Burn Hazards
Recall number
18199
Sold / distributed
Bed Bath & Beyond, Home Depot, Menards, Orchard Supply, Target and other stores nationwide and online at Amazon.com, Target.com, Vornado.com and other websites from August 2009 through March 2018 for about $30.

Why it was recalled

The electric space heater can overheat when in use, posing fire and burn hazards.

What was recalled

This recall involves Vornado VH101 Personal Vortex electric space heaters sold in the following colors: black, coral orange, grayed jade, cinnamon, fig, ice white and red. The heaters measure about 7.2 inches long by 7.8 inches wide by 7.10 inches high and have two heat settings (low and high) and a fan only/no heat setting. "Vornado" with a "V" behind it is printed on the front of the unit. The model/type "VH101," serial number and ETL mark are printed on a silver rating label on the bottom of the unit.

What to do

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led heaters and contact Vornado for instructions on how to receive a full refund or a free replacement unit.. Follow the official notice for full instructions.
